How do I get rid of the black border in Illustrator?

1 Correct answer. Use your direct select tool and select the black outline of the shape that you want removed, and then change the stroke color to none.

Where is create outlines in Illustrator?

  1. Select the type that you want to convert into outlines. Once this is selected scroll over to the “Type” drop down at the top of your screen.
  2. Select “Create Outlines” from the drop down.

How do I convert an outlined text back to editable text in Illustrator?

The Text Recognition plug-in for Illustrator is a new OCR tool that converts outlined copy in artwork to editable text. No more work-arounds. Just use the Text Recognition plug-in for Adobe® Illustrator® to convert outlines to text.

What is Ctrl y in Illustrator?

For Adobe Illustrator, pressing Ctrl + Y would change the view of your art space into a black and white screen showing you only the outline.

How do I turn off edges in Illustrator?

In Illustrator, you can show or hide anchor points, direction lines, and direction points by choosing the View menu, and then choosing Show Edges or Hide Edges.

How do I delete everything outside a shape in Illustrator?

Move the black shape to the front, select the black and green shapes, and select Object > Clipping Mask > Make. The black will disappear, but you can direct-select it and replace the black fill.

Why do you create outlines in Illustrator?

Basically, you change the text into an object, so you can no longer edit that text by typing. The plus side is that it saves you the trouble of sending fonts to everyone who wants to use the file. Turning text into outlines makes it appear as though your text was created with the Pen tool.

How do you outline an image in Illustrator?

Choose File > Place and select an image to place into Illustrator document. The image is selected. Open Appearance panel and from the Appearance panel flyout menu, choose Add New Stroke. With the Stroke highlighted in the Appearance panel, choose Effect > Path > Outline Object.

How do I remove a page border?

Go to Design > Page Borders. In the Borders and Shading box, on the Page Border tab, select the arrow next to Apply to and choose the page (or pages) you want to remove the border from. Under Setting, select None, and then select OK.
